Best 48185 Michigan Public Preschools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 1,288 students in 48185, MI.
The top-ranked public preschools in 48185, MI are Wildwood Elementary School and Universal Learning Academy.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public preschools in zipcode 48185 have an average math proficiency score of 14% (versus the Michigan public pre school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 21% (versus the 40% statewide average). Pre schools in 48185, MI have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Michigan public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 21%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Michigan public preschool average of 41% (majority Black).
